Selected civil wrongs are grouped alongside one another as torts under typical legislation techniques and delicts underneath civil regulation devices.[193] To obtain acted tortiously, a single must have breached a obligation to a different man or woman, or infringed some pre-present legal right. A straightforward example may be unintentionally hitting somebody using a ball.[194] Beneath the legislation of negligence, the most typical kind of tort, the hurt occasion could most likely assert payment for his or her accidents from the occasion liable. The concepts of carelessness are illustrated by Donoghue v Stevenson.

Very first website page with the 1804 version of the Napoleonic Code Civil law may be the legal technique Employed in most nations around the world throughout the world today. In civil law the sources recognised as authoritative are, mostly, legislation—Specially codifications in constitutions or statutes handed by govt—and tailor made.[b] Codifications day back millennia, with just one early instance being the Babylonian Codex Hammurabi. Modern-day civil legislation units essentially derive from legal codes issued by Byzantine Emperor Justinian I within the 6th century, which were rediscovered by eleventh century Italy.[80] Roman regulation in the times with the Roman Republic and Empire was greatly procedural, and lacked a professional legal course.[81] As an alternative a lay magistrate, iudex, was decided on to adjudicate. Decisions weren't posted in any systematic way, so any circumstance legislation that developed was disguised and almost unrecognised.[82] Every circumstance was for being determined afresh from the guidelines in the State, which mirrors the (theoretical) unimportance of judges' selections for potential cases in civil regulation techniques today. From 529 to 534 Advert the Byzantine Emperor Justinian I codified and consolidated Roman law up right until that point, to make sure that what remained was just one-twentieth in the mass of legal texts from right before.

Precedent along with the doctrine of stare decisis Participate in a substantive role in legal selection-building by making sure consistency and balance while in the regulation. Precedent refers to former Civil Rights court decisions which tutorial upcoming cases with similar details or legal issues. Stare decisis, that means “to face by matters decided,” will be the theory that courts need to adhere to those precedents.
